Like lavender, heliotrope blooms in bright purple flowers sure to attract various species of butterflies. A butterfly can see color and knows the most vibrant blooms provide the sweetest nectar.

America imported approximately $2.26 billion worth of fresh-cut flowers in 2024, with Colombia accounting for 60% of the market and Ecuador following with 25%, according to US Census Bureau data.
